ICT Manager for Monitoring and WAN
(Location Belgrade - Resident position)
Purpose of the post
Under the direct supervision and guidance of the Head of ICT for EURASIA in Belgrade, the mission of the ICT Manager for Monitoring and WAN (WRSM) is to do the follow up of the continuity of the operations of critical ICT Infrastructure in the Region, including the main elements of Site Servers and WAN connections, while cooperating with local and HQ ICT staff towards fault’s preventions and service optimization. This should be done by applying procedures, using tools and managing files and relationships with internal and external interlocutors.
Main tasks
- Organizes and executes the Monitoring of the critical ICT Infrastructure and Services in the Region using the standardized tools and scope agreed within the ICRC’s ICT Monitoring service definition.
- Manage the ICRC’s WAN service in the Region’s sites, following the “Run” and “Organic growth” processes with external connectivity providers and with the WAN Management in HQ, analyse quotations and consistency with the agreed designs and price book.
- Measures and establishes baselines and does a follow-up of critical parameters in the infrastructure to act proactively and avoid incidents, contributing to business continuity.
- Effectively establishes an early warning system to escalate incidents or alerts to the concerned ICT Specialists, to the Global Service Desk or to the providers’s ServiceDesk for further escalation.
- Verify the WAN service quality in coordination with site responsible, trace the SLA compliance and contribute with information analysis to the solutions to problems.
- Establish a regular reporting process according to agreed templates and distributes the outcome to Regional ICT staff and HoICT. Generates ad-hoc reports upon request of HoICT.
- Keep updated documentation of the WAN and Servers infrastructure, including the evolution and change management.
- Assist the HoICT EURASIA to the follow up of Regional files or activities.
Required profile
- Bachelor's degree in a field of Information and Communication Technologies with 4 years work experience in a similar function in ICT (monitoring and connectivity services).
- Excellent command of written and spoken English (minimum to equivalent B2 CEFR level).
- Self-learner, high degree of autonomy, proven organizational and interpersonal skills.
- Good analytical (including the use of MS Excel as tool), planning and organizational skills.
- Certification on Microsoft Systems Operation and Administration (MCSA Windows Server or MCSE Server Infrastructure).
- Certification on Cisco Switching and Routing (CCNA or CCNP).
- Proved experience on exploitation of Network Management Systems (NMS), particularly in “Solarwinds” is an asset.
Assets
- Good level of understanding of French language.
- Formal training and / or certifications in IT Service Management (ITIL framework).
- Work experience on Regional positions covering several countries concurrently.
- Experience with data telecommunication services management (ISPs or Data carriers).
